Display a domain transient property in scaffolded views


In my Grails 1.3.7 project I have a domain class like this:

class User {

String login
String password
String name
String passwordConfirmation

static constraints = {
    login       unique:true, blank:false, maxSize:45
    password    password:true, blank:false, size:8..45, 
                matches: /(?=.*\d)(?=.*[a-z])(?=.*[A-Z])(?!.*\s).*/
    name        blank:false, maxSize:45
    passwordConfirmation display:true, password:true, validator: { val, obj ->
        if (!obj.properties['password'].equals(val)) {
            return ['password.mismatch']
        }}
}

static transients = ['passwordConfirmation']

String toString() {
    name
}

}

And I'm using scaffold for the corresponding create/edit actions.

My problem is that even if I marked passwordConfirmation constraint to be displayed, it isn't shown at the scaffold views. Is there something that I'm missing to make transient properties to be displayed? Is it possible?

Thanks


Solution

  • By default grails doesn't create the fields in views for transient properties. You could manually add them on each view or if you have a lot of them and are using the scaffolded views you could do the following:

    Install the view templates:

    grails InstallTemplates
    

    Then open the relevant templates in src/templates/scaffolding

    and modify the line that reads:

    persistentPropNames = domainClass.persistentProperties*.name
    

    to

    persistentPropNames = domainClass.properties*.name
    

    for each of the templates. This is a bit of a bodge, but it should work and you can further edit the template to include/exclude any properties you like.
